基于FPGA的高精度计时器设计与实现
版权申诉
65 浏览量
更新于2024-06-29
收藏 220KB DOCX 举报
FPGA计时器设计
摘要:本设计基于FPGA(Field-Programmable Gate Array)技术,设计了一种高精度计时器,包括时钟分频模块、开关及控制模块、显示模块三个功能模块。使用VerilogHDL语言进行逻辑功能仿真与时序验证,并在FPGA开发板上进行了综合和适配。该计时器支持秒、分计时、清零、开始、暂停等功能。
知识点:
1. FPGA的定义和特点:FPGA(Field-Programmable Gate Array)是一种现场可编程门阵列,具有设计灵活、速度快、功耗低的特点,在集成电路设计中得到广泛应用。
2. 高精度计时器的应用:高精度计时器常用于体育竞赛及各种要求有较精确定时的技术领域中。
3. 计时器的设计实现:本设计使用VerilogHDL语言,采用自顶向下的方法,完成了计时器的设计,最后在FPGA开发板进行测试。
4. FPGA开发板的应用:FPGA开发板是基于FPGA技术的开发平台,能够实现复杂的数字电路设计和仿真。
5. HDL语言的应用:HDL(Hardware Description Language)语言是一种用于描述数字电路的语言,常用于FPGA和ASIC设计中。
6. VerilogHDL语言的应用:VerilogHDL是一种基于HDL的语言,常用于FPGA和ASIC设计中,能够描述数字电路的行为和结构。
7. FPGA的设计流程:FPGA的设计流程包括设计思想、方案选择与论证、硬件功能描述、软件设计、调试等步骤。
8.计时器的功能模块:计时器包括时钟分频模块、开关及控制模块、显示模块三个功能模块,每个模块都有其特定的功能和设计要求。
9. FPGA的应用领域:FPGA技术广泛应用于数字电路设计、通信系统、计算机系统、消费电子产品等领域。
10.计时器的应用场景:高精度计时器常用于体育竞赛、科学研究、工业生产、医疗保健等领域中。
总结:本设计基于FPGA技术,设计了一种高精度计时器,具有秒、分计时、清零、开始、暂停等功能。该设计使用VerilogHDL语言,采用自顶向下的方法,完成了计时器的设计,最后在FPGA开发板进行测试。
2023-02-24 上传
2023-06-10 上传
2023-09-04 上传
2023-05-30 上传
2023-05-31 上传
2023-06-09 上传
G11176593
- 粉丝: 6811
- 资源: 3万+
最新资源
- WPF渲染层字符绘制原理探究及源代码解析
- 海康精简版监控软件:iVMS4200Lite版发布
- 自动化脚本在lspci-TV的应用介绍
- Chrome 81版本稳定版及匹配的chromedriver下载
- 深入解析Python推荐引擎与自然语言处理
- MATLAB数学建模算法程序包及案例数据
- Springboot人力资源管理系统:设计与功能
- STM32F4系列微控制器开发全面参考指南
- Python实现人脸识别的机器学习流程
- 基于STM32F103C8T6的HLW8032电量采集与解析方案
- Node.js高效MySQL驱动程序:mysqljs/mysql特性和配置
- 基于Python和大数据技术的电影推荐系统设计与实现
- 为ripro主题添加Live2D看板娘的后端资源教程
- 2022版PowerToys Everything插件升级,稳定运行无报错
- Map简易斗地主游戏实现方法介绍
- SJTU ICS Lab6 实验报告解析